The hits keep coming ... Via @marissa_meador: Indiana senator's business faces bomb threat in 'troubling pattern' as GOP urges civility
indystar.com
Sen. Andy Zay is the sixth Indiana senator to face a threat of violence or swatting attempt this week amid the redistricting fight.

Via @hayleighcolombo at IndyStar: Fourth Indiana GOP senator swatted amid redistricting fight. Report comes the same day as incident reported at state Sen. Spencer Deery's West Lafayette home.
indystar.com
Sen. Rick Niemeyer, R-Lowell, who has been so far undecided on redistricting, was "involved in an attempted swatting incident" on Nov. 19.

Paula Copenhaver, who announced a primary challenge of Sen. Spencer Deery in Senate District 23, on this morning's 'swatting' incident: "This is unacceptable - swatting and political violence are never the answer. ..." 1/
Indiana Sen. Spencer Deery’s West Lafayette home targeted in ‘swatting’ report Thursday morning amid redistricting blowback. Deery becomes the third state senator targeted by false reports as redistricting debate continues.
